This book is a collection of 32 Chapters divided into three Sections Namely Thematic Contributions, Manufacuturing and Services. These are the work of experienced quality professionals working in various leading organizations countering VUCA (Volatile, Uncertain, Complex, and Ambiguous) challenges mainly from this part of the world.
